Unable to Print on Cloud

Issue: When trying to print from a cloud server or remote server, the default printer is showing that it is connected but it will not print. Printing a test page results in an error.

 

Explanation: The issue is caused by an incompatibility between the server and the printer’s drivers. This is typically found when they use the drivers that Microsoft finds when adding a printer.

 

Resolution: The issue can be resolved by downloading and installing generic printer drivers on the local computer that is connecting remotely. I have found the best way to find the legitimate drivers is to search for the printer and look for the windows server drivers. Uninstall the printer and reinstall using the drivers you download from the website. Once installed you can do a test print locally and it should print without issue. Once tested, connect to the server and try printing a test page. This may not always work and more investigation may be required. Past experiences required a completely separate driver from a different printer to get the printing to work on the server.
